12110 Zip Code Historical First Ancestry Data
ACS 2010-2014 data
19,549 (89.52%) out of the total population of 21,837 reported first ancestry.
12110 Zip Code | % of the Total Population | New York | U.S. | |
Arab | 245 | 1.12%, see rank | 0.81% | 0.56% |
Czech | 143 | 0.65%, see rank | 0.28% | 0.47% |
Danish | 33 | 0.15%, see rank | 0.18% | 0.42% |
Dutch | 618 | 2.83%, see rank | 1.25% | 1.40% |
English | 1,771 | 8.11%, see rank | 5.38% | 8.02% |
French | 1,625 | 7.44%, see rank | 2.93% | 3.34% |
German | 3,012 | 13.79%, see rank | 10.62% | 15.03% |
Greek | 238 | 1.09%, see rank | 0.77% | 0.41% |
Hungarian | 135 | 0.62%, see rank | 0.76% | 0.46% |
Irish | 6,065 | 27.77%, see rank | 12.41% | 10.80% |
Italian | 4,099 | 18.77%, see rank | 13.28% | 5.52% |
Norwegian | 116 | 0.53%, see rank | 0.42% | 1.42% |
Polish | 1,725 | 7.90%, see rank | 4.82% | 3.01% |
Portuguese | 0 | 0.00%, see rank | 0.27% | 0.44% |
Russian | 535 | 2.45%, see rank | 2.21% | 0.92% |
Scotch-Irish | 184 | 0.84%, see rank | 0.35% | 0.99% |
Scottish | 280 | 1.28%, see rank | 1.06% | 1.72% |
Subsaharan African | 152 | 0.70%, see rank | 1.27% | 0.95% |
Swedish | 69 | 0.32%, see rank | 0.62% | 1.27% |
Swiss | 86 | 0.39%, see rank | 0.18% | 0.30% |
Ukrainian | 155 | 0.71%, see rank | 0.69% | 0.31% |
American | 719 | 3.29%, see rank | 5.03% | 7.12% |
Welsh | 162 | 0.74%, see rank | 0.42% | 0.57% |
